Example of the bug:

tt <-  expression(paste("test
looo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ooo(% of 360" *degree,")"))
plot(1,xlab=tt,ylab=tt,main=tt)

#Now please resize the window to a smaller window to see how the text in
ylab disappears
#(but not the xlab or title.)

#This also seems to affect vertical rotated expressions:
plot(1)
text(1,1,tt,srt=90)
text(1,1,tt,srt=0)
text(1,1,tt,srt=45)
#At least on windows.
#On Linux (so Barry wrote), all the rotated texts seems to disappear.
